Output 6888699acc7cdd6e772c499c38af983f0d895339f2ce083570fd872709ea8547:0

value
535066139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ba9595f8f4146329418ff21fab78a3fcf631953 OP_EQUAL
address
3QdgQGxWStg48rMBcuoGLR3PHwk33bhrnC
transaction
6888699acc7cdd6e772c499c38af983f0d895339f2ce083570fd872709ea8547
spent
true